The European Union does not set one language rule for the Erasmus Mundus Scholarship. Each course decides on its own. Some accept a medium of instruction letter in place of a test score.

No. The IELTS exam is not strictly mandatory for studying in Ireland. This is because most universities in Ireland accept alternative English tests as well and some of these universities might even waive the requirement for English test scores if your previous years of education (for up to a certain defined number of years) were done in English.

For admission to Bath Spa Uni, Indian students are required to submit an IELTS score. The minimum scores required in IELTS for admission to Bath Spa Uni are given below. 

Course LevelMinimum Scores
UG6.0 overall
For most PG courses6.5 overall
For a few UG courses6.5 or 7.0

Bath Spa Uni also accepts TOEFL / PTE scores/ But, the minimum scores required in these tests vary as per the courses.

The minimum IELTS score required for admission to UT Dallas is 6.5. Other equivalent test scores required are-

TestsMinimum Scores
TOEFL80
Duolingo105
PTE67

Yes, Indian students can study at Kingston Uni London without IELTS, provided they have a valid high-school qualification or a Medium of Instruction (MOI). Students who meet the below criteria are eligible for an English language waiver at Kingston London:

PostgraduateUndergraduate
  • Medium of Instruction Letter valid for up to 5 years
  • Franchise and Affiliated provision permitted by an MOI will not be acceptable
  • Higher Secondary School Certificate with a minimum overall score of 70% in English

Yes, Indian students who want to take admission to Regent's Uni London can have IELTS waiver if they meet the following conditions-

BoardsUGPG
CBSE70%70%
State Board (Karnataka, Maharashtra, West Bengal)75%75%

Yes. It is possible to study in the UK without IELTS by taking alternative English tests. Indian students can get complete on English test requirement if their schooling/significant years of education were completed in English. For this, they'll be required to submit an MOI certificate; check the MOI accepted universities in the UK.
